Exploring the Name Nova
Now, let's zoom in on "Nova." While "Nova" isn't a traditional Arabic name, it has gained popularity globally due to its modern and celestial appeal. The word "nova" comes from Latin, meaning "new." In astronomy, a nova refers to a star that suddenly increases in brightness before gradually fading back to its original state. This association with brightness, newness, and celestial phenomena gives the name a unique and positive vibe. Think about it – who wouldn't want a name that suggests brilliance and a fresh start?

How Muslims Adapt Non-Arabic Names
Many Muslims today choose names that aren't strictly Arabic but have beautiful meanings that resonate with Islamic principles. The key is to ensure the name doesn't contradict Islamic teachings or have negative connotations. Names reflecting positive attributes, natural beauty, or virtuous qualities are often embraced. For example, names that signify wisdom, strength, compassion, or hope can be suitable choices.
When considering a non-Arabic name like "Nova," Muslim parents often evaluate its meaning and symbolism. If the name carries a positive message and aligns with Islamic values, it can be a perfectly acceptable choice. It’s also common for families to combine a non-Arabic name with a traditional Arabic middle name to maintain a connection to their cultural and religious heritage. This approach allows parents to honor both modern preferences and traditional values, creating a harmonious blend that reflects their identity.
